Cambridge IELTS 16 Academic Listening Test 1 Part 3

theme
Click to show definition
(n) /θim/ the main subject or idea of something Example: The theme of the project is very interesting.
wildlife
Click to show definition
(n) /ˈwaɪldˌlaɪf/ animals and plants that live in the natural environment Example: I saw some wildlife in the forest.
introductory
Click to show definition
(adj) /ˌɪntrəˈdʌktəri/ related to the beginning or first part of something Example: The introductory stage was easy to complete.
handout
Click to show definition
(n) /ˈhænˌdaʊt/ a printed paper given to help people learn or understand something Example: The teacher gave us a handout with important information.
aspect
Click to show definition
(n) /ˈæs.pɛkt/ a particular part or feature of something Example: She is exploring different aspects of photography.
texture
Click to show definition
(n) /ˈtɛkstʃər/ the feel or appearance of a surface or substance Example: The texture of the painting was very smooth.
letdown
Click to show definition
(n) /ˈlɛtˌdaʊn/ a disappointment or a situation that is not as good as expected Example: The event was such a letdown because no one showed up.
pour
Click to show definition
(v) /pɔr/ to make a liquid flow out of a container Example: I pour the juice into a glass.
evolution
Click to show definition
(n) /ˌɛvəˈluːʃən/ the process by which living things change over a long time Example: The museum has many displays about evolution.
brainstorm
Click to show definition
(v) /ˈbreɪnˌstɔrm/ to think of new ideas or solutions Example: Let's brainstorm some topics for the presentation.
draft
Click to show definition
(v) /dræft/ to write a first version of a document Example: I need to draft my ideas before the meeting.
proposal
Click to show definition
(n) /prəˈpoʊ.zəl/ a suggestion or plan put forward for consideration Example: I need to write a proposal for my project.
amend
Click to show definition
(v) /əˈmɛnd/ to make changes to something to improve it or correct it Example: I need to amend my proposal before I submit it.
evaluate
Click to show definition
(v) /ɪˈvæljuˌeɪt/ to judge or calculate the quality, importance, or value of something Example: I need to evaluate my work before submitting it.
timeline
Click to show definition
(n) /ˈtaɪmˌlaɪn/ a plan that shows important events in the order they happened Example: The teacher asked us to create a timeline for our history project.
mind map
Click to show definition
(n) /maɪnd mӕp/ a diagram that shows ideas connected to a central concept Example: I made a mind map to organize my thoughts for the essay.
rationale
Click to show definition
(n) /ˌræʃ.əˈnæl/ the reasons for doing something Example: He explained his rationale for choosing that topic.
precise
Click to show definition
(adj) /prɪˈsaɪs/ exact and accurate Example: The teacher wants a precise answer to the question.
scope
Click to show definition
(n) /skoʊp/ the range of things that a subject, activity, or situation includes Example: The project has a wide scope for creativity.
vague
Click to show definition
(adj) /veɪg/ not clear in meaning Example: The instructions were a bit vague.
falcon
Click to show definition
(n) /ˈfæl.kən/ a type of bird of prey that can fly very fast Example: I saw a falcon flying high in the sky.
stare
Click to show definition
(v) /stɛr/ to look at something for a long time Example: The cat likes to stare at the bird outside.
swoop
Click to show definition
(v) /swup/ to move quickly through the air, often downwards Example: The bird will swoop down to catch the fish.
talon
Click to show definition
(n) /ˈtælən/ a sharp claw on a bird's foot Example: The eagle caught the fish with its talon.
predator
Click to show definition
(n) /ˈprɛdətər/ an animal that hunts other animals for food Example: A lion is a powerful predator in the jungle.
concentrate
Click to show definition
(v) /ˈkɒn.sən.treɪt/ to focus your attention or mind on something Example: I need to concentrate on my homework.
impression
Click to show definition
(n) /ɪmˈprɛʃən/ an effect or influence that something has Example: The impression of the painting was very strong.
rapid
Click to show definition
(adj) /ˈræp.ɪd/ happening very quickly Example: The car was moving at a rapid speed.
motion
Click to show definition
(n) /ˈmoʊʃən/ the act of moving or changing place Example: The motion of the bird in the sky was beautiful.
perch
Click to show definition
(v) /pɜːrtʃ/ to sit or rest on a branch or another raised place Example: The bird likes to perch on the fence.
reed
Click to show definition
(n) /riːd/ a tall plant that grows near water Example: The kingfisher sat on a reed by the river.
shade
Click to show definition
(n) /ʃeɪd/ a dark area or shape made when something blocks light Example: The tree provides shade on a hot day.
litter
Click to show definition
(n) /ˈlɪtər/ small pieces of trash or waste that are not put in a bin Example: People should not throw litter on the ground.
portrait
Click to show definition
(n) /ˈpɔrtrɪt/ a painting, drawing, or photograph of a person Example: She showed us a portrait of her grandmother.
middle-aged
Click to show definition
(adj) /ˈmɪdəl eɪdʒd/ being in the middle of life, usually between 45 and 65 years old Example: He is a middle-aged man who enjoys painting.
expression
Click to show definition
(n) /ɪkˈsprɛʃən/ a way to show thoughts or feelings Example: His expression showed that he was sad.
suggest
Click to show definition
(v) /səɡˈdʒɛst/ to offer an idea or plan for someone to think about Example: She suggested a new way to solve the problem.
ambiguous
Click to show definition
(adj) /æmˈbɪɡ.ju.əs/ having more than one possible meaning or interpretation Example: The instructions were quite ambiguous, so I asked for clarification.
exploit
Click to show definition
(v) /ɪkˈsplɔɪt/ to use something in a way that gives you an advantage Example: Companies often exploit natural resources for profit.
natural world
Click to show definition
(n) /ˈnætʃərəl wɜrld/ the physical environment, including plants, animals, and natural resources Example: The students learn about the natural world in their science class.
reference
Click to show definition
(n) /ˈrɛfərəns/ a mention of something Example: I found a good reference for my report.
existence
Click to show definition
(n) /ɪɡˈzɪstəns/ the state of being real or living Example: The existence of many animals is threatened.
fist
Click to show definition
(n) /fɪst/ the hand when the fingers are bent in tightly Example: He made a fist to show he was angry.
carefully
Click to show definition
(adv) /ˈkɛr.fəl.i/ in a way that avoids harm or mistakes Example: He holds the bird carefully.
research
Click to show definition
(n) /ˈriːsɜːrtʃ/ a careful study to find out new information Example: I need to do some research for my school project.
outcome
Click to show definition
(n) /ˈaʊtˌkoʊm/ the result or effect of a process or event Example: The outcome of the game was surprising.
explore
Click to show definition
(v) /ɪkˈsplɔːr/ to look around or travel to discover new things Example: I want to explore new places this summer.
unsure
Click to show definition
(adj) /ʌnˈʃɔr/ not certain about something Example: I am unsure about the answer to the question.
dangerous
Click to show definition
(adj) /ˈdeɪndʒərəs/ able or likely to cause harm or injury Example: The wild animal can be dangerous.
kingfisher
Click to show definition
(n) /ˈkɪŋˌfɪʃər/ a type of bird that eats fish and has bright feathers Example: I saw a kingfisher sitting by the lake.
cycle
Click to show definition
(n) /ˈsaɪ.kəl/ a series of events that happen repeatedly in the same order Example: The seasons change in a cycle.
